- Small and friendly adults-only site 10 minutes' drive from Shrewsbury
- A 15-minute drive to Wroxeter Roman City; Ironbridge half an hour
- Five-acre site with a bar and shop; shared kitchen; dedicated dog walk
Site type
- Guests under the age of 18 are not allowed on site.
- The site does not accept breeds/crossbreeds listed in the Dangerous Dogs Act (i.e. XL Bully, Pit Bull Terrier, Japanese Tosa, Dogo Argentino, and Fila Brasileiro).
- The grocery shop is open between 24/03 and 30/10.
- No hen/stag parties permitted via Pitchup.com.
- Commercial vehicles (vehicles used for work-related purposes, carrying goods or fare-paying passengers) and sign-written vehicles are not permitted on site.
- 7 kWh of electricity is included in the nightly price and any usage beyond this is metered on site at £0.29 per kWh.

What customers say
This is a very well-maintained, peaceful, adult-only site with spacious, private pitches. Visitors praise the immaculately clean facilities, friendly and helpful staff, and the cosy on-site bar. Many reviewers highlight the beautiful grounds and convenient location for exploring the area. Some minor points mentioned include occasional issues with the electric hook-up app and a desire for more lighting at night.
